Output 597c17451cb29bd628d0301373dc46fe2fa30fef6561c5d086a46901ef88141a:0

value
162670362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f1864b34f17d668c9b7afae8b6465c65e75e1c4 OP_EQUAL
address
3DH2xnaZY15SpXL3VNJaZtjwXUR3EUGNyY
transaction
597c17451cb29bd628d0301373dc46fe2fa30fef6561c5d086a46901ef88141a
spent
true